The first teaser of the upcoming film "Now You See Me 2" has been released by Entertainment One and Summit Entertainment, and the magicians will be returning with a few new faces.

The old cast of Mark Ruffalo, Woody Harrelson, Jesse Eisenberg, Dave Franco, Michael Caine and Morgan Freeman return for the sequel of the 2013 American thriller "Now You See Me".

While Isla Fisher is not returning as Henley, Lizzy Caplan has joined the cast as the newest member of the Four Horsemen along with Ruffalo, Harrelson, Eisenberg and Franco.

However, the biggest highlight of the trailer is the introduction of "Harry Potter" star Daniel Radcliffe, who will play the role of Walter Tressler, son of Arthur Tressler from the first movie, who seeks to bring the Four Horsemen to justice after his father's imprisonment.

Jon M Chu, known for directing movies like "Step Up 2: The Streets", "Step Up 3D," and "G.I. Joe: Retaliation", has replaced Loius Letterier as the director of this sequel.

From the looks of the trailer, it seems the film will be follow the original formula from the first movie – flashy illusions and tricks, vibrant cinematography, and emphasis on the charisma of the leading cast.

The formula worked for the first film, and there is no reason why it shouldn't work for the sequel as well. Lionsgate, which is already developing a third film for the franchise, has concurred on this.

However, there are some aspects that have been completely ignored in the trailer. For example, there is no explanation regarding the non-appearance of Henley's character. It seems the other cast members are totally okay with this, though, and don't even care she is missing from the team.

Another significant cast member from the first film, Melanie Laurent, is also not returning, and it has absolutely no effect on any of the male members.
